Artist Liner ($19.00) (New, Permanent)

MAKE UP FOR EVER introduces Artist Liner, a highly pigmented, gliding eye pencil that offers endless creative possibilities to effortlessly define and enhance eyes. With colors ranging from a carbon, matte black to an iridescent pop of purple, Artist Liner gives eyeliner a bold update for fall. 

Artist Liner is a twist-up, gliding eye pencil that delivers intense color payoff in a range of shades. The formula is especially silky and blendable for easy application, and the twist-up pencil means never having to sharpen. The ultra-creamy texture can draw a bold, long-lasting line, or can be blended out for a smoky effect. A combination of Oils and Waxes give Artist Liner smudge-proof properties, while Polymers and Pigments work to provide a long-wearing result and color intensity. Available in 15 hues in Matte, Metallic, Iridescent, Diamond, and Satin finishes, play up your eyes and play with color for a classic or creative look that can take you from day to night.
